ad-free

Channel / Source: ESPN
Title: The Kansas City Chiefs 'cannot run the ball, period' | SportsCenter | ESPN
Published: 2017-11-26
Source: https://www.youtube.com/watch?v=UpMaBPo7Zns

TITLE:
The Kansas City Chiefs 'cannot run the ball, period' | Sp...

SECTION: